Below are a few reminders and details about our social doubles events:

- Please arrive 10 minutes early so that we can start on time!
- Players of all levels are welcome to participate (no doubles experience required)
- We provide balls for each court
- If you can’t make it please email board@seattletennisalliance.com or text the host in our Whatsapp Group

The exact format varies but generally we have a set of play with an initial pairing and then we rotate or switch partners.

If the weather is looking questionable, we will generally make a call around 1 hr before the start. If we do cancel, you‘ll receive an email notification and credit for future social doubles events.

Please let the host know if you have any special needs or preferences and we’ll do our best to accommodate!

Pac Cup Captain Mark Hanses will be hosting a Texas Hold‘em night fundraiser in Capitol Hill.

Food and drink will be provided. $40 entry fee for poker. If you get eliminated early or just want to stock up, you can "re-buy" more chips for another $10 or $20.

No experience necessary, You don‘t need to be a hotshot poker player - we will teach you how to play. It‘s a really fun night, we raised over $900 for the team last year.

- 7pm mingle
- 8pm play starts!

Non-tennis and non-pac cup friends are also welcome to join. 1/2 Proceeds will go to help pay for Pac Cup team fees. The other 1/2 will be prize money for the winners.

RSVP by emailing Mark Hanses at mhanses@windermere.com. Hope to see you there!
